How Will Everseen and Google Cloud Transform Retail with Vision AI?

Retail operations are on the brink of a significant transformation thanks to the cutting-edge collaboration between Everseen and Google Cloud, aiming to harness the potential of Vision AI. This innovative partnership will see Everseen’s Vision AI platform, which utilizes a network of 120,000 Edge AI endpoints to process an immense volume of video data, seamlessly integrated with Google’s robust cloud infrastructure, including Google Distributed Cloud and Vertex AI platform. The primary objective of this integration is to minimize shrinkage, boost customer engagement, and reduce waste in retail environments.

The technological synergy between Everseen and Google Cloud is expected to offer scalable and seamless solutions to retailers around the globe by leveraging Google’s advanced hardware and software support. This initiative provides end-to-end visibility across retail operations, empowering retailers to identify sources of inventory loss and make data-driven decisions to enhance their bottom line. Additionally, this AI-powered solution has the potential to significantly elevate the shopping experience by ensuring greater efficiency and a higher level of service within retail stores.
